Android 消息处理机制估计都被写烂了,但是依然还是要写一下,因为 Android 应用程序是通过消息来驱动的,Android 某种意义上也可以说成是一个以消息驱动的系统,UI、事件、生命周期都和消息处理机制息息相关,并且消息处理机制在整个 Android 知识体系中也是尤其重要,在太多的源码分析的文章讲得比较繁琐,很多人对整个消息处理机制依然是懵懵懂懂,这篇文章通过一些问答的模式结合 Android 主线程(UI 线程)的工作原理来讲解,源码注释很全,还有结合流程图,如果你对 Android 消息处理机制还不是很理解,我相信只要你静下心来耐心的看,肯定会有不少的收获的。